Considering Flight Schools in Florida?
You’ll really enjoy going to school in Florida if you like beaches. This state is between the Gulf of Mexico and the Atlantic Ocean. There are miles and miles of coastline. The warm weather means you’ll be able to enjoy the beaches all year round. Over 22 million people visited the state between January and March in 2010.

The three largest cities in the state are Jacksonville, Miami and Tampa. Jacksonville is on the shore of the Atlantic Ocean in the northeast part of the state. Miami is in south Florida on the Atlantic Coast. Tampa is on the Gulf Coast near the middle of the state. These three cities have similar climates. Temperatures during the day range from about 60 in the winter to around 80 in the summer. Miami is a little warmer than Jacksonville and Tampa. Temperatures in Miami are as high as 69 in the winter and 83 in the summer.

You’ll be able to swim and sunbathe along Jacksonville’s 20 miles of beaches. The St. Johns River runs through the city. There’s a lot to do at The Jacksonville Landing on the riverfront. You can have a leisurely meal at the restaurants overlooking the river or have a snack at the indoor food court. You’ll be able to buy souvenirs and handmade goods at the shops. There’s live entertainment here on the weekends. Visiting the Jacksonville Maritime Museum at the Landing will give you an overview of the area’s maritime history.

Other museums in Jacksonville are the Museum of Science and History, the Cummer Museum of Art & Gardens and the Museum of Contemporary Art. Historic sites in the area include the Kingsley Plantation from the late 18th century and the Merrill House from the 19th century.

Miami is about 345 miles south of Jacksonville. You’ll find plenty of beaches here. There’s a lot to do on the beaches besides swimming and sunbathing. You can walk, bike, fish and jog. You’ll be able to camp or go boating along the Snake River near the beach at Oleta River State Park.

There are other attractions in Miami. The Vizcaya Museum and Gardens has 10 acres of gardens. You can take a Behind-the-Scenes Tour at Zoo Miami to get a close look at the animals or interact with dolphins at the Miami Seaquarium.

You’ll find a variety of things to do in Tampa if you’re in training there. There are plenty of places for sunbathing on the beaches. You can get a look at Tampa Bay when you take a dinner cruise or a sunset cruise. A visit to Busch Gardens will give you a chance to see African animals on a Serengeti Plain tour. You can parasail above the beaches or speed through the water on jet skis.
